A Discontinued Journey in SCP: Facility
SCP: Facility aimed to immerse players in a chilling world populated by creatures and objects locked in a secretive research facility. However, this intriguing project is no longer in development and will permanently remain unreleased due to funding issues. Despite its discontinuation, the concepts and ideas surrounding the game continue to attract interest among fans of the survival horror genre.
